I've been reading the best of H. P. Lovecraft's stories and have been greatly inspired by him to draw the creatures that he describes. This creature is inspired by his story "The Nameless City". This race has no name, but they once thrived in a coastal city, which one day was ruined due to the ocean receding and their once coastal home is now a desert. During the time they also grew to hate man. Now what is left of their race dwells deep underground in their nameless city, hidden away from man.
